Gold at three-month low on global cues
Extending losses for the eighth straight day, gold prices tumbled to trade at a three-month low of Rs. 27,600 per ten gram by falling Rs. 150 in the national capital on Tuesday on sustained selling by stockists amid a weakening global trend. Ban on e-rickshaws in Delhi to continue, rules High Court
The Delhi High Court on Tuesday ruled that the ban on plying of e-rickshaws on the roads of the Capital will continue till the rules and regulations for them are framed by the Union Road Transport Ministry. HC confirms death penalty for Pune rogue driver
The Bombay High Court on Tuesday confirmed the death sentence on Pune rogue driver Santosh M. Mane, who two years ago hijacked a state transport bus and killed nine people. NEW DELHI: A day after the Supreme Court issued notice to CBI director Ranjit Sinha for allegedly protecting some accused in 2G case, its another bench today sought explanation from the top cop on similar allegations in the coal scam.
